Fruit Tart
1.
Prepare the ingredients and preheat the oven to 200 degrees.
2.
Stir the whipped cream and milk evenly.
3.
Pour in the egg yolk.
4.
Stir well.
5.
Pour in powdered sugar and condensed milk and mix well.
6.
Stir well.
7.
Sift the egg tart liquid three times.
8.
spare.
9.
Cut the fruit into pieces and set aside.
10.
Place the custard crust on the baking tray.
11.
Put different fruit pieces separately.
12.
Pour in the egg tart water, and it's 80% full.
13.
Put it in the preheated oven.
14.
Fire up and down at 200 degrees for about 18 minutes.
15.
Bake until focus appears on the surface of the tart.
16.
Eat while it's hot.
Tips:
1. The fruit pellets can be replaced at will.
2. The temperature and time are for reference only.
3. In winter, egg tart wrappers need to be taken out and thawed in advance.
